Fire safety has always been one of those “we’ll get to it” things—until we realized our upstairs bedrooms had only one exit. A near kitchen fire a few years ago pushed us to finally prepare. We looked at several options, from rope ladders to retractable metal ones. The Kidde brand stood out for its combination of weight capacity (up to 1,000 lbs) and strong reputation for home safety gear. The 25-foot length made it perfect for our three-story layout, especially since other models capped at two stories.
There isn’t much maintenance needed, which we love. We did a brief check after two months of storing it—the metal parts hadn’t rusted, and the straps were still firm. Kidde recommends keeping it in a dry indoor area; we’d avoid basements or garages. There’s no official warranty paperwork in the box, but the construction inspires confidence. We plan to inspect it once or twice a year just for peace of mind.
Tips, Tricks, and Care
- Assign a specific window for this ladder and make sure everyone knows where it’s stored.
- Do one careful dry run (safely) so the process feels familiar.
- Use rubber-soled shoes during drills for better stability.
- Check rungs and hooks yearly for corrosion or wear.
- Label the storage box clearly to save time in an emergency.
